Sudha Reddy Attends Dadasaheb Phalke International Film Festival Awards 2025 as Guest of Honour

Posted on November 12, 2025 By

Philanthropist and global humanitarian leader Sudha Reddy adds grace, prestige and international influence to the awards night. 

Mumbai (Maharashtra) [India], November 12: Dadasaheb Phalke International Film Festival Awards 2025 witnessed an evening of grandeur, artistic brilliance and cultural pride as Mrs Sudha Reddy, distinguished philanthropist, entrepreneur and global cultural advocate, graced the ceremony as the Guest of Honour. Held on 30th October 2025 at the iconic Dome, SVP Stadium, Worli, Mumbai.

The occasion commenced with the sacred Lamp Lighting Ceremony, where Mrs. Sudha Reddy joined Honourable Ms. Pankaja Munde, Minister of Environment & Climate Change, Animal Husbandry, Government of Maharashtra and National Secretary BJP and Maharani Radhikaraje Gaekwad Ji, scion of the Royal Family of Baroda. Together, the three distinguished women inaugurated the evening by illuminating the ceremonial lamp, symbolising enlightenment, creativity and the legacy of Shri Dadasaheb Phalke Ji, the Father of Indian Cinema. Their collective presence reflected a powerful message of cultural stewardship, women-led leadership and India’s continued advancement in the arts, a memorable highlight applauded by dignitaries and audiences alike.

As part of the evening’s proceedings, Mrs. Reddy presented one of the most significant international honours, the Best International Actress Award, conferred upon acclaimed Oscar-nominated actress Karla Sofía for her performance in Emilia Pérez.
